Orion Mars-mission lifts off on time for 4½-hour test flight

Friday, December 5, 2014 - 07:30 in Astronomy & Space

NASA successfully launched its new Orion spacecraft on time this morning, after gusty wind and sticky valves held up the critical test flight Thursday.
